Understand How The Biogas Route Boosts The Economy Of Paraná By Integrating Agribusiness, Renewable Energy And Sustainable Transport, Generating Regional Development And Cost Reduction.

Over the past few decades, the discussion about energy in Brazil has been primarily linked to large infrastructure projects, such as hydropower plants, and more recently, to renewable sources, such as solar and wind energy.

However, in recent years, a new protagonist has gained space in the energy and economic debate, especially in the southern part of the country. In this context, in Paraná, the biogas route is increasingly solidifying as a strategy capable of uniting regional development, environmental sustainability, and economic competitiveness in a lasting way.

Historically, Paraná has built a solid and diversified agricultural base. With the advancement of mechanized agriculture and intensive livestock farming, the state has naturally started to deal with large volumes of organic waste generated by animal protein production.

For a long time, however, producers and municipalities viewed this waste merely as an environmental liability. Consequently, additional costs and challenges for proper management of this material arose.

With technological advancement and, at the same time, the implementation of policies aimed at energy transition, this scenario began to change gradually.

Thus, what was once just an environmental problem began to generate economic and energy opportunities. In this way, the conversion of waste into biogas and, later, into biomethane laid the foundations for a new production chain in the field, connecting sustainability, innovation, and income generation in a structured manner.

The Origin Of The Biogas Route And Its Connection To Transport

In this scenario of transformation in the field and logistics, the biogas route emerges as a strategic response. In an integrated manner, it connects rural production, energy infrastructure, and sustainable transport, bringing different links of the state economy closer together.

By transforming agricultural waste into renewable fuel, Paraná strengthens a production chain that involves rural producers, cooperatives, energy companies, logistics providers, and the public sector.

Moreover, this articulation progressively enables the use of biomethane in heavy transport, allowing for the gradual replacement of diesel on highways.

In this way, trucks that travel long distances and carry out the flow of agro-industrial production start to use a cleaner and more competitive fuel. As a result, the logistics sector aligns with the new environmental and economic demands.

From a historical perspective, it is worth noting that road transport has always sustained the economy of Paraná. Over time, the state has established itself as a logistical link between the southern, southeastern, and central-western regions.

However, although this dependency on diesel has ensured efficiency for decades, it has also brought relevant economic and environmental challenges. Therefore, currently, the scenario demands more modern and sustainable solutions.

Sustainable Corridors And Energy Matrix Diversification

In light of these challenges, the biogas route responds directly and aligns, especially, with global demands for decarbonization and energy efficiency. In recent years, therefore, the state government has started to encourage the creation of sustainable road corridors.

In these corridors, the supply of natural gas and biomethane meets both long-distance routes and regional paths linked to agribusiness.

Additionally, this strategy consistently expands the diversification of the energy matrix. By integrating biomethane with solutions such as electrification, ethanol, and biodiesel, Paraná reduces the dependence on imported fossil fuels.

Consequently, the state strengthens its long-term energy security.

In this context, the biogas route is increasingly establishing itself as an essential axis of future transport. Not only because it reduces emissions but also because it stimulates fleet modernization, encourages the adoption of more efficient vehicles, and creates a favorable environment for technological innovation in the logistics sector.

Economic Impacts On Municipalities In Paraná

As a direct consequence of these initiatives, the municipalities involved are beginning to see positive economic effects. Regions like Campos Gerais and areas near supply routes, for example, attract investments in biomethane plants, gas distribution networks, and associated services.

Thus, this movement boosts the local economy, generates direct and indirect jobs, and increases municipal revenue.

Furthermore, by reducing logistical costs, biomethane strengthens the competitiveness of Paraná’s agricultural production. In this way, producers and transport companies begin to use a cheaper fuel produced locally.

As a result, operational efficiency increases and profit margins improve throughout the production chain.

Another relevant factor pertains to cost predictability. While diesel prices depend on the international oil market and exchange rate fluctuations, biomethane is locally produced.

Therefore, this characteristic reduces exposure to external fluctuations and ensures greater stability for companies’ financial planning.

Gas Infrastructure And Long-Term Investments

At the same time, the expansion of gas infrastructure in Paraná reinforces this process of economic transformation. Long-term investments in the construction of new gas pipelines and the connection of thousands of new customers clearly demonstrate that the state sees biomethane as part of a lasting energy strategy.

Moreover, by integrating renewable gas into the existing network, Paraná creates a favorable environment for new industrial projects.

Thus, the state attracts private investments and continuously strengthens the biogas route. This advancement, in turn, encourages the interiorization of development, bringing infrastructure and opportunities to regions outside the major urban centers.

In the same way, the installation of new plants in strategic municipalities highlights the decentralized nature of this transformation.

Instead of concentrating energy production, the biogas route distributes investments, income, and innovation, strengthening regional economies and promoting greater territorial balance.

Environmental Benefits And Sustainable Development

In addition to economic gains, the biogas route generates relevant environmental benefits. Primarily, the replacement of diesel with biomethane significantly reduces greenhouse gas emissions in heavy transport.

Considering that this is one of the most challenging sectors to decarbonize, the positive impact becomes even more significant.

At the same time, the use of organic waste improves environmental management in the field. Thus, the state reduces risks of soil and water contamination and encourages more responsible agricultural practices.

As a result, this virtuous cycle reinforces Paraná’s image as a reference in sustainability and energy innovation.

In this scenario, the state begins to occupy a prominent position in the Brazilian energy transition. The biogas route, therefore, demonstrates that Paraná can align economic, environmental, and social interests in a practical and efficient manner, without compromising growth.

Finally, looking to the future, it is clear that the biogas route has the potential to become one of the pillars of the Paraná economy.

After all, its ability to generate value from waste, reduce logistical costs, stimulate investments, and promote sustainability makes it a strategic and timeless solution. Thus, Paraná not only transforms its energy matrix but also builds a solid path for long-term economic development.
